## v2.8.0 — Canary gating update

Heads up, plugin folks: Glimmerhost now blocks canary promotion if your plugin's error rate climbs above 0.5% during the bake window. No more sneaking past with a quick retry loop — the gate checks rolling averages. Update your manifests to declare health endpoints before the next release train. Questions about gating rules go to our canary lead.

account owner for yahog-kafop: Istius Rusix

### Step 4: Split the user module

Extract `users/` from the Thornbeck monolith into the new `idcore` service. Copy the model files, not the controllers. Run the schema export script first; it generates the migration set in `out/migrations`. Do not run migrations against the monolith DB. The new service gets its own dedicated database, already provisioned in staging. Apply the generated migrations there, then run the smoke suite. Connect to the new database with the string below.

replica DSN, kajep-yahag: mssql://praok_svc:iF@db-8d68.plorvaio.local:5432/eliion

// Default page size for the Orbiwell public REST API.
// Plugin authors: clients may request up to 200 items, but responses
// are capped server-side and cursors expire after ten minutes, so
// always follow the `next` link rather than computing offsets.
// This cap was tuned against the build identified just below.

pipeline stamp: htk31_f769b577b3028a4e9958e5bb8d1259a

Subject: Queuebridge cut-over summary

Hi — as of last night, all producers formerly writing to our homegrown Taskmill queue now publish through Queuebridge. The legacy tables remain read-only for fourteen days in case we need to replay stragglers. Dead-letter handling moved to a dedicated topic, so alerts will look different; please skim the new dashboard before your shift. No consumer lag observed since switchover. For reference during incidents, the production settings now in effect are listed below.

settings of fafog-haduf:
ZORIX_PIN=4648
ZORIX_METRICS_HOST=metrics.zorix.paliqsys.corp
ZORIX_LOG_LEVEL=info
ZORIX_TENANT=druix